Abstract
A transition element-doped aluminum powder metal and a method of making this powder metal are disclosed. The method of making includes forming an aluminum-transition element melt in which a transition element content of the aluminum-transition element melt is less than 6 percent by weight. The aluminum-transition element melt is then powderized to form a transition element-doped aluminum powder metal. The powderization may occur by, for example, air atomization.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A powder metal comprising:
a transition element-doped aluminum powder metal; wherein one or more transition elements are homogenously dispersed throughout the transition element-doped aluminum powder metal and wherein the transition element-doped aluminum powder metal contains less than 6 weight percent of the one or more transition elements.
2 . The powder metal of claim 1 , wherein the transition element-doped aluminum powder metal is air atomized.
3 . The powder metal of claim 1 , wherein the one or more transition elements are selected from a group consisting of iron, nickel, titanium, and manganese.
4 . The powder metal of claim 1 , wherein at least one ceramic additive is added up to 15 volume percent.
5 . The powder metal of claim 4 , wherein the at least one ceramic additive is SiC.
6 . The powder metal of claim 5 , wherein the at least one ceramic additive is AlN.
7 . The powder metal of claim 1 , wherein the one or more transition elements include 1 weight percent iron and 1 weight percent nickel.
8 . The powder metal of claim 1 , wherein the one or more transition elements are doped into a 2324 aluminum alloy.
9 . The powder metal of claim 8 , wherein the one or more transition elements include 1 weight percent iron and 1 weight percent nickel.
10 . The powder metal of claim 8 , wherein the 2324 aluminum alloy includes 3.8-4.4 weight percent copper, 1.2-1.8 weight percent magnesium, 0.3-0.9 weight percent manganese, no more than 0.10 weight percent chromium, no more than 0.25 weight percent zinc, no more than 0.10 weight percent silicon, no more than 0.12 weight percent iron, and no more than 0.15 weight percent titanium.
11 . The powder metal of claim 10 , wherein the one or more transition elements include 1 weight percent iron and 1 weight percent nickel.
12 . The powder metal of claim 1 , wherein a powder metal part formed from the transition element-doped aluminum powder metal has fewer intermetallics formed along grain boundaries of the part in comparison to a powder metal part made from a powder metal of similar composition but with the transition element added as an elemental powder or as part of a master alloy.Cited by (0)
